-The Lemon Nedra-

My In-laws just brought us a bag of lemons from their backyard tree in California &  I wanted to use the lemons for a family dessert. Everyone was happy with it. This cheesecake served 4 & was kind of reverse engineered from a lemon tart I ate in L.A. If you have a lemon tree this is a nice way to use the fresh lemons! no cooking needed, just a blender or a food processor.


--------------
 Crust:
 in a food processor pulse the following ingredients until they become a dough.

 -1/2 cup almond flour
-1 1/2 cups shredded coconut
-2 tablespoons coconut sugar or brown sugar
 -1/4 teaspoon sea salt
-2 tablespoons agave
-1 tablespoon coconut oil
-3 pitted dates
 --------------
 Filling:
 in a blender blend up the following ingredients until smooth.

 -1 1/2 cup pumpkin seeds
-1/3 cup meyer lemon juice
-1/3 cup agave
-1/3 cup coconut oil
-1/4 cup nut milk
-1 tsp vanilla
-1/4 tsp sea salt
-2 tablespoons lemon zest
 -------------------------------------------
 pack the crust on the bottom of a 9 inch tart pan or any dish you like & freeze for 15 minutes before adding the filling.
pour filling on top & decorate with mint or any fruit. refrigerate for a few hours before serving.
